How to Identify Service Records Without Photos

You can use the Service History Report in Yeti to review service records for a specific client or site and quickly identify records that do not have photos attached.

Step 1: Navigate to Service History Reports

From the Yeti Web Dashboard, navigate to Reports → Service History.

Step 2: Filter the Service Records


Using the filters, select:

  • The Client or Site you would like to review
  • The Date Range you would like to include

Once you've selected your criteria, click Filter.

Note: Filtering the report also acts as a Select All, selecting the service records returned by your search.

Step 3: Configure the Report Fields

Click Online & PDF Fields Configuration.

From here, you can turn off any information you don't need to include in the report.

If the sole purpose of the report is to identify service records without photos, we recommend keeping only the necessary fields, such as:

  • Site or Client
  • Photos

Once you've selected the information you want to include, click Save.

Step 4: Send the Online Report

Click Send All Online.

Enter the email address where you would like the report sent and send the report.

 

Step 5: Open the Report

The report should arrive by email fairly quickly, although larger reports with many service records may take a little longer to generate.

Open the Online Report from the email.

The report will display the service information you selected along with any photos associated with each service record.

Step 6: Identify Records Without Photos

Review the report and look for service records where no photos are displayed.

This allows you to quickly identify which services for the selected client or site do not have photo documentation attached.

Tip: Keeping the report fields to a minimum makes it much easier to scan through a large number of service records and spot those that are missing photos.
